Amazon.co.uk Review
Keeping with the grand new tradition of country music stars breathing new life into the latter parts of their careers, Loretta Lynn's
Van Lear Rose finds the coal miner's daughter teaming up with White Stripes svengali Jack White, who produces, plays guitar and duets on "Portland Oregon" (where he's easily outshined by Lynn). And, like the later work of Johnny Cash and Dolly Parton, the result is a resounding success.
White is a traditionalist at heart and he treats Lynn's music with both respect and restraint; this is most definitely a country album, though it's a rocking one. Pedal steel, dobro, banjo and fiddle are all here, alongside White's blues-tinged electric guitar, but the star is Lynn's voice: worn, warm and full of heart. Her storytelling abilities come to the fore on the title track, the album's highlight, and her ability to spin a phrase in a country way is highlighted on songs like "Family Tree" (a tale of a wife confronting her husband's lover) and the lament "Miss Being Mrs". But really, there isn't a dud track here, from the celebratory stomp of "High on a Mountain Top" to the restrained spiritual "God Makes No Mistakes", to the accompanied spoken-story "Little Red Shoes". White's contribution should open Lynn's music up to a well-deserved wider audience. Really, though, one would be hard-pressed to find a better album by this country legend. --Robert Burrow
Album Description
Loretta Lynn is one of the most iconic and inspirational women in country music; one of her biggest fans is Jack White from the White Stripes. Jack and Loretta have collaborated to create Van Lear Rose.
Loretta's music and lyrics are unavoidably influenced by her extraordinary life. Born into poverty, being married at 13, having four children by the age of 18 and then being the first country female to become a millionaire has shaped Loretta into the artist she is today. This remarkable story was told in her autobiography, A Coal Miner's Daughter, which was made into an Oscar-winning film of the same name.
